THE MP Boxing Promotion is staging the ?Tibay ng Pinoy XIII: X?mas Slugfest? on December 19 at 5 p.m. at the Panabo Gymnasium in Panabo City.
Undefeated Genesis Libranza of MP Davao Stable will face former Philippine Boxing Fedeeration (PBF) flyweight champion Juan ?Purisima? Purisima of General Santos City in the 10-round main header.
The 22-year old Libranza is still undefeated with eight straight wins with five knockouts and no draw. He now has three wins this year including two by knockouts.
In his last outing, the native from Bayugan, Agusan del Sur scored a convincing unanimous decision against Michael Rodriguez last Sept. 6 at Barangay Labangal Gym in General Santos City.
The 5-foot-5 Libranza earlier stopped Romulo Ramayan Jr. by a 6th round technical knockout last April 5 at the Panabo Freedom Park in Panabo. It was followed by a 2nd round TKO win over Rodel Tejares at the Lagao Gym last May 30.
?Gusto nako na limpiyo gihapon akong record human sa 2015,? said Libranza.
Purisima (11-8-1) is coming off from a 9th round technical knockout loss from the hands of world-rated Jerwin ?Pretty Boy? Ancajas, a stablemate of Libranza, on May 30 at the Lagao Gym in Gensan.
The 24-year old Purisima fought but lost for the World Boxing Association International flyweight title by a unanimous decision to Artem Dalakian on August 24, 2013 at Donbass Aren in Donetsk, Ukraine.
Purisima stopped Renren Tesorio via a 5th round TKO to win the vacant PBF flyweight crown on June 1, 2013 at the Mandaluyong Gym.
Purisima, however, also bowed to WBC world flyweight champion Roman ?Chocolatito? Gonzales of Nicaragua by a 3rd round TKO on April 6, 2014 in Tokyo, Japan.
?Purisima is now a hungry fighter. He wants to win again,? said promoter Joven Jimenez of MP Promotions USA.
More exciting fights will also be featured in the undercard. The fights will also be featured in the ?Blow by Blow Reloaded? TV show of 8-time world division champion Manny Pacquiao.
?It will be free again to the public as our Christmas boxing presentation in coordination with Councilor Ferdinand Gocon? said Jimenez. ? LITO DELOS REYES
